Sierra Vista Middle School’s Science Olympiad team earned the prestigious title of Southern California Science Olympiad Champions. This marks the fourth consecutive title for the team.
Students from the District's nationally recognized honors ensemble chorus and orchestra performed in front of a capacity audience. Board President Katie McEwen accepted $2 million check from the Irvine Company to support music, art and science in IUSD.
IUSD students excelled at the State Science and Engineering Fair, with 10 students achieving top-four positions and several honorable mentions and sponsored awards.

IUSD is launching the Early College Program for incoming 9th-grade students starting the 2025-26 school year. Courses are UC/CSU transferable and can lead to IGETC Certification or even an associate’s degree with additional units.

Two Northwood High School juniors, Kamron Jamali and Kathleen Shumate, were selected as California State Thespian Officers.

Nearly 30 students from IUSD secured top honors at the recent Orange County Science and Engineering Fair (OCSEF) across diverse categories.
